Output e5cf59af247edaa7e891964ecfda1720aa6eaefc767a2f90babb23f97db18a77:1

value
10482648
script pubkey
OP_0 OP_PUSHBYTES_20 bf5e90b03dd8167c1df1da880e1b2304add152de
address
bc1qha0fpvpamqt8c803m2yquxerqjkaz5k7ja0s8n
transaction
e5cf59af247edaa7e891964ecfda1720aa6eaefc767a2f90babb23f97db18a77
spent
true